Now, let me introduce to you how to make jam buns. 1.12 High-gluten flour, milk powder, eggs, fine sugar, dry yeast, salt, butter, water, homemade pineapple jam. 2.21 Add yeast powder, salt, milk powder and fine sugar to the flour and mix well. Then add the eggs and mix well. Use clean water to knead the flour into dough. 3.12 Knead the dough evenly with your hands. 4.21 Cut the butter into small pieces and put them on the dough. Stretch the dough diagonally with your hands to wrap the butter. Then fold and knead it back and forth in the basin. Knead the dough while folding. This method is the post-oil method of kneading the dough. Knead the dough until the oil and surface are basically blended and then take it out. 5.1 Knead and beat the dough until the gluten is formed. This is the so-called complete stage. 6.2 Put the dough on the chopping board, grab one end with your hand and beat it repeatedly, folding and kneading it while beating. 7.1 Cover with plastic wrap or a wet towel for basic fermentation. 8.2 After beating and kneading the dough until it is soft and elastic, roll it into a ball and put it into a steel bowl. 9. When the dough has fermented to twice to two and a half times its size, poke a hole with your finger to test the fermentation effect of the dough. If the hole in the dough does not bounce back, it proves that the dough has fermented properly. 10. Take out the dough that has completed basic fermentation, place it on the chopping board and flatten it to expel the air inside. 11. Then roll the dough into a ball, cover it with plastic wrap and let it relax for 15 minutes. 12. After relaxing for 15 minutes, divide the dough into ten pieces. 13. Then roll the dough into balls one by one, flatten them and put in the fillings. 14. After putting the fillings in place, hold up the dough with your hands, and seal the dough with the base between your thumb and index finger. Use the method of rotating, pinching, and folding to seal the dough tightly. 15. Then place the bread with the seam facing down on the baking tray. 16. After making the bread dough one by one, put it into the oven and carry out the final fermentation at a temperature of 28-35 degrees. 17. After the dough has fermented to twice its size, take it out and use a brush to apply a thin layer of maltose water on the surface of the dough (the ratio of maltose to water is one to six, that is, one part sugar to six parts water). 18. After applying the sugar water, set the oven to 190 degrees, preheat for 5 minutes, and then bake at 190 degrees with upper and lower fire for 15-18 minutes. 19. The bread can be taken out of the oven when the crust turns golden brown. 20. This bread is now ready. After it cools down a bit, you can store it in a fresh-keeping bag.
